Alexander Wolff 《Informatik - Forschung und Entwicklung》2007,22(1):23-44
This paper deals with automating the drawing of subway maps. There are two features of schematic
subway maps that make them different from drawings of other networks such as flow charts or organigrams.
First, most schematic subway maps use not only horizontal and vertical lines, but also diagonals. This
gives more flexibility in the layout process, but it also makes the problem provably hard. Second, a subway
map represents a network whose components have geographic locations that are roughly known to the users
of such a map. This knowledge must be respected during the search for a clear layout of the network.
For the sake of visual clarity the underlying geography may be distorted, but it must not be given up, otherwise
map users will be hopelessly confused.
In this paper we first give a rather generally accepted list of rules that should be adhered
to by a good subway map. Next we survey three recent methods for drawing subway maps, analyze their
performance with respect to the above rules, and compare the resulting maps among each other and to official
subway maps drawn by graphic designers. We then focus on one of the methods, which is based on mixed-integer
linear programming, a widely-used global optimization technique. This method guarantees to find a drawing
that fulfills a subset of the above-mentioned rules (if such a drawing exists) and optimizes a weighted
sum of costs that correspond to the remaining rules. The method can draw even large subway networks such
as the London Underground in an aesthetically pleasing manner, similar to maps made by professional graphic
designers. If station labels are included in the optimization process, so far only medium-size networks
can be drawn. Finally we give evidence why drawing good subway maps is difficult (even without labels). 相似文献

[目的/意义] 目前,非物质文化遗产信息资源的组织以网站为载体,多采用传统树状或星状链接进行导航,且以地域分割,无法全面展示非物质文化遗产特色,弱化了其价值。采用新技术合理组织非物质文献遗产信息资源对非物质文献遗产的宣传与保护有重要意义。[方法/过程] 基于主题图理论和方法,建立非物质文化遗产信息资源主题图模型,并以作为世界非物质文化遗产的京剧、昆曲为例,辅以Ontopia主题图开发工具,展示非物质文化遗产信息资源主题图的生成及组织效果。[结果/结论] 主题图不仅能够合理、全面地组织非物质文化遗产信息资源,还能够以可视化的方式直观展示非物质文化遗产的历史渊源、传承脉络、流派发展等特殊属性,具有重要的实践意义。 相似文献

专业社交媒体中主题图谱的内容包括论坛中的主题及主题之间的关系,其具有挖掘专业产品创新方向、构建专业知识索引等重要应用价值。本文基于深度学习技术与文本挖掘技术,提出了专业社交媒体中的主题图谱构建方法。首先,使用专业社交媒体中的文本训练Skip-Gram模型,利用该模型的隐藏层权重与模型输出的预测结果,分别获取词语间的语义相似度与上下文关联度。其次,基于该语义相似度与上下文关联度,对已有领域种子本体词汇进行扩充,将语义相似或上下文相邻近的词汇纳入本体词汇,为主题抽取提供高质量的领域词汇。然后,基于扩充的专业本体词汇,使用结合本体词汇的LDA主题模型从专业社交媒体文本中抽取主题与主题词。最后,利用语义相似度与上下文关联度,定义关联度权重,通过图模型与谱聚类,获取主题间与主题词的关联关系与层次结构。本文使用汽车论坛语料进行主题图谱生成实验。实验结果表明,本文方法获取的主题词纯净度相比单独使用LDA模型提升了20.2%,且能够清晰合理地展现主题之间的关系。 相似文献
